These are some of the skincare and wellness things I do regularly to lighten my daily routine!

1. Eyebrow dye: I have red hair, which means red eyebrows, which means very faint eyebrows! I love the color of my hair, but I wished for a long time that I had more definition in my eyebrows. For the past few years, I’ve been using a medium brown color from Just For Men’s beard dye to make my eyebrows more prominent! It costs like $10 at the store and it takes maybe 7 minutes total to apply, wait, and wash the dye off.

2. Silicone patches: I have very fair skin, which means I’m pretty susceptible to damage from the sun. I wear SPF and have a solid skincare routine, but I have noticed I’m developing tiny lines around my eyes and on my forehead. I’m hesitant to do Botox (no hate to those who do!! please be kind 🥺) but still want to make sure I’m doing everything possible to prevent long term damage to the skin. Dr Shereene Idriss made a video on TikTok about how this was a promising alternative to Botox, having slower and less noticeable results but still offering some protection from the formation of fine lines over time. I put it on before bed on my forehead and under my eyes and pull it off in the morning! I haven’t been using it that long, but I do notice my face is softer and more moisturized in these areas in the morning.

3. Electric toothbrush: An electric toothbrush has completely changed my dental hygiene! I used to brush for 4+ minutes with a regular toothbrush to feel as clean as when I use the electric toothbrush. It’s so much better at getting in between teeth and underneath gums that I don’t feel as guilty or embarrassed if I forget to floss (which happens more than I’d like to admit . . .).

4. Hydrogen peroxide rinse: Continuing with dental hygiene, I feel like this step has been so easy to add to my routine while making all the difference. Once a week, after brushing and flossing at the end of the day, I mix equal parts hydrogen peroxide and water and gently swish it around my mouth for anywhere from 30 seconds to as long as I can stand to keep it in my mouth. Hydrogen peroxide is an “oral debriding agent” meaning it helps remove layers of plaque in the mouth, but it also has whitening properties and is usually one of the active ingredients in teeth whiteners! I used to spend a lot of money on whitening strips and now feel content with this at home remedy. I started off using this rinse every day for one week, then I switched to once a week to help maintain the whiteness and to fight off plaque.

5. Eyelash curler: I have never really liked the way I look with mascara on and I don’t really know why. I love the look of long eyelashes, but something about mascara on my eyes always look clumpy and doesn’t really complement my look, no matter what brand I use. Most days I just do a casual makeup look anyway, and I find that my eyelashes mesh with my makeup so much better when I just use aquaphor/vaseline with an eyelash curler. The aquaphor adds a really subtle glow to my lashes and makes the curl stay put longer. I usually can have them stay curled all day when I use this method! Coconut oil also works really great for this.

6. Lotion/Coconut oil mix: I always feel like lotions and moisturizers, no matter how “intense” they are, leave me feeling like I need to reapply shortly after. For a while, I switched to coconut oil and felt like this was hydrating, but it was also very oily and took a long time to actually absorb into my skin. Then, I mixed both! I noticed it was absorbing faster into my skin while also keeping a protective hydrating layer on top, which is exactly what I need during the winter, after being outside, and after exfoliating as my skin gets SUPER dry during these times. I love being able to moisturize once and then not having to keep up with it throughout the day!
